  6. cod4source says:

    The G36c does have advantages over the M4, they are just difficult to display clearly in the chart. Basically when you use the sights the G36c sways much less than the M4. If you crouch or go prone with the G36c the gun sway decreases even more. The G36c is unique in this manner, it is the only primary weapon whose sway depends on your position. The G36c also has a different recoil than the M4. So there are several reasons to choose the G36c over the M4.

  42. me says:

    the G36c has more recoil than the M4 but i prefer the G36c because when you are looking through the sights or the red dot it has WAYYY less sway so you can single shot and Easily get long range kills (unlike the m4)……. the AK-47 range/damage stats are the same with the red dot or the silencer…this is the Only weapon in the game that the Red Dot affects range/damage. the AK with iron sights has damage of 40/30…..The AK with the Red Dot or silencer has damage of 40/20.. wich means at longer range the AK will only do 20 damage instead of 30…. and at close range it will still do 40 damage….in COD4, when a weapon is silenced it doesnt really reduce the range… it simply lowers the damage at longer ranges….i hope that helped clear up some stuff
